I’d like to share @goldzun ’s response to the topic of chat on Xbox:
“We understand that chat is the most highly requested Xbox feature, and its something we wish to add soon. There is a fair amount of work to get chat to be compliant and feel native on Xbox, which is why it was removed. ”
